英文名 N,1-diphenyltetrazol-5-amine
英文别名 1-phenyl-5-(phenylamino)tetrazole
N,1-diphenyl-1H-tetrazol-5-amine
phenyl-(1-phenyl-1H-tetrazol-5-yl)-amine
N,1-Diphenyl-1H-tetraazol-5-amine
1-Phenyl-5-(phenylamino)(1H)tetrazole
5-anilino-1-phenyltetrazole
Phenyl-(1-phenyl-1H-tetrazol-5-yl)-amin
密度 1.27g/cm3
沸点 422ºC at 760 mmHg
分子式 C13H11N5
分子量 237.26000
闪点 209ºC
精确质量 237.10100
PSA 55.63000
LogP 2.47890
折射率 1.688
